(AMSF) reported first‑quarter 2026 earnings per share (EPS) of $0.50, missing the consensus estimate of $0.5525 by 9.5%. The company did not disclose revenue figures during the period. In response, the stock declined 0.81%, reflecting investor disappointment with the earnings shortfall.

Observing multiple datasets reduces the chance of oversight. AMSF’s Q1 2026 results indicate that the company faced headwinds in its core workers’ compensation insurance operations. The 9.5% EPS miss suggests that underwriting margins were likely compressed by elevated claim severity or adverse loss development during the quarter. In the workers’ compensation market, rising medical costs and wage inflation have been persistent challenges, and AMSF may have experienced similar pressures. The company’s relatively small premium base means that even modest changes in loss ratios can have a pronounced effect on earnings. Additionally, investment income, while typically stable, may have been impacted by a shifting interest‑rate environment. Although AMSF has historically maintained disciplined underwriting standards, the Q1 earnings miss raises questions about the near‑term trajectory of its combined ratio. Without revenue disclosures, investors must rely on premium growth indicators from industry data to assess top‑line momentum. Overall, the operational narrative points to a quarter where cost pressures overshadowed any potential volume gains.

Looking ahead, AMSF may need to intensify its focus on pricing adequacy and risk selection to protect margins. The company’s management likely remains cautious about the broader economic environment, as slowing payroll growth could temper demand for workers’ compensation coverage. Given the earnings miss, guidance for the remainder of 2026 might emphasize expense control and loss‑ratio improvement. However, no official forward‑looking statements have been issued for future quarters. The company’s ability to pass through higher premiums to clients will be critical, especially if medical cost trends remain elevated. Regulatory changes in certain states could also influence reserve levels. For now, the lack of explicit revenue data leaves the top‑line picture incomplete, but the EPS shortfall suggests that bottom‑line recovery may take longer than anticipated. Strategic priorities, such as renewals and retention efforts, will be closely watched. While AMSF’s niche in hazardous‑industry workers’ comp offers some insulation, any sustained uptick in claims frequency or severity could further pressure results.

The stock’s 0.81% decline following the earnings announcement reflects a muted but negative reaction, indicating that the EPS miss was not catastrophic but still disappointed investors. Analysts may revise their near‑term earnings estimates downward, tempered by the lack of revenue disclosure. The cautious sentiment is likely reinforced by industry headwinds that could persist into mid‑2026. What to watch next: AMSF’s second‑quarter filings should provide clarity on premium trends and loss development. Any commentary on pricing actions or reserve releases will be especially important. The company’s ability to stabilize its combined ratio and return to meeting consensus expectations will determine whether the stock can regain its footing.
